Output 8c54f66bf543ad1899a79b871eb1a2898541f5b28f75b127e70fa4edd43150e6:8

value
214038257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ce5040d744cf1bac73e153e8d8833c6e2db034 OP_EQUAL
address
MRfCUZJq1YmyaiWpgjgo5ozuQ7yJZjK943
transaction
8c54f66bf543ad1899a79b871eb1a2898541f5b28f75b127e70fa4edd43150e6
spent
true